WOLFRAM SYSTEM MODELER

ChopperBuckBoost

Bidirectional chopper

This is a bidirectional buck / boost - converter with 2 transistors and 2 freewheeling diodes.

Parameters (11)

useHeatPort

Value: false

Type: Boolean

Description: = true, if heatPort is enabled

T

Value: 293.15

Type: Temperature (K)

Description: Fixed device temperature if useHeatPort = false

RonTransistor

Value: 1e-05

Type: Resistance (Ω)

Description: Transistor closed resistance

GoffTransistor

Value: 1e-05

Type: Conductance (S)

Description: Transistor opened conductance

VkneeTransistor

Value: 0

Type: Voltage (V)

Description: Transistor threshold voltage

RonDiode

Value: 1e-05

Type: Resistance (Ω)

Description: Diode closed resistance

GoffDiode

Value: 1e-05

Type: Conductance (S)

Description: Diode opened conductance

VkneeDiode

Value: 0

Type: Voltage (V)

Description: Diode threshold voltage

useConstantEnable

Value: true

Type: Boolean

Description: Disable boolean input and use constantEnable, if true

constantEnable

Value: true

Type: Boolean

Description: Constant enabling of firing signals

m

Value: 1

Type: Integer

Description: Number of phases
